Is Nintendo Online Switch Worth It?

There are a few things to consider when determining whether the Nintendo Switch Online subscription is worth it for you. The main thing to keep in mind is what kinds of games you like to play and how often you play them online. If you’re someone who enjoys playing online multiplayer games or frequently uses features like the eShop or game save backups, then the subscription may be worth it for you.

Otherwise, you may be better off saving your money. The Nintendo Switch Online subscription gives access to online multiplayer modes for compatible games, as well as other features like the eShop and game save backups. For many people, the main draw will be the ability to play online multiplayer games with friends.

The selection of multiplayer-compatible games is growing all the time, so if this is something you’re interested in, it’s definitely worth considering a subscription. Another feature that could be useful for some players is cloud saves. This allows you to back up your game data online, so even if something happens to your Switch console, you won’t lose all your progress.

This could be particularly handy for anyone who travels frequently or has had issues with their Switch hardware in the past. Finally, there’s also access to exclusive offers and discounts through the Nintendo Switch Online service. These can include things like deals on digital games or special prices on select items in the eShop.

If any of these perks sound appealing to you, then a subscription could end up being worth it after all.

The Nintendo Switch Online app for smart devices lets you extend your gameplay experience even further. With this app, you can use voice chat with friends during online play in compatible games, invite friends to play online with you in supported games, and receive notifications about when your favorite Nintendo Switch Online members are playing certain games. The app also gives you access to SplatNet2, where you can view stage schedules for Splatoon 2 and check out stats like how many inklings or octolings you’ve splatted.

You need a Nintendo Switch Online membership to use this app.
